Location: Goron Mountain
Cost: 30 rupees
Objective: skiing using a shield as a ski. You have to do different stunts, pressing different buttons combinations to get points. The more points you get, the best the prize will be.
Possible Rewards:
- 5000 points, Heart Piece
- 4000 points, Secret Seashell
- 3000 points, Great Quiver
- 5000 + points, 50 rupees (this can onle be obtained after getting the heart piece)

Description: a skiing competition in which Link will have to avoid getting hit by the rocks and do stunts to get points within a certain amount of time. Depending on the shield used the better the stunts will be. There may also be secret passages to enable to do much greater stunts.

Dangers:
- Rock slides
- Columns
- Rocks scattered around

How to avoid dangers
- To avoid rock slides the player must quickly move aside
- To avoid getting hit against columns, the player must jump, or move aside
- To avoid the rocks scattered around, the player must jump over them
